guix-commits
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

227/308: gnu: Add rust-wayrs-scanner-0.15.


From: guix-commits
Subject: 227/308: gnu: Add rust-wayrs-scanner-0.15.
Date: Wed, 4 Dec 2024 16:21:16 -0500 (EST)

efraim pushed a commit to branch rust-team
in repository guix.

commit 943d00fa9d401e830f32a296ce25c6c716f9c5e7
Author: Efraim Flashner <efraim@flashner.co.il>
AuthorDate: Wed Dec 4 14:57:19 2024 +0200

    gnu: Add rust-wayrs-scanner-0.15.
    
    * gnu/packages/crates-graphics.scm (rust-wayrs-scanner-0.15): New
    variable.
    (rust-wayrs-scanner-0.13): Inherit from rust-wayrs-scanner-0.15.
    
    Change-Id: I87692dd48036aa91a4d59a965d3105e99feeb8d6
---
 gnu/packages/crates-graphics.scm | 28 +++++++++++++++++++++++-----
 1 file changed, 23 insertions(+), 5 deletions(-)

diff --git a/gnu/packages/crates-graphics.scm b/gnu/packages/crates-graphics.scm
index 40b3c68c32..09f8386693 100644
--- a/gnu/packages/crates-graphics.scm
+++ b/gnu/packages/crates-graphics.scm
@@ -5712,21 +5712,20 @@ xml files.")
 with wayrs-client.")
     (license license:expat)))
 
-(define-public rust-wayrs-scanner-0.13
+(define-public rust-wayrs-scanner-0.15
   (package
     (name "rust-wayrs-scanner")
-    (version "0.13.2")
+    (version "0.15.0")
     (source
      (origin
        (method url-fetch)
        (uri (crate-uri "wayrs-scanner" version))
        (file-name (string-append name "-" version ".tar.gz"))
        (sha256
-        (base32 "07xzg36rnnsb4z4rd82r2mk3y05vg1ssfwrry2kd4yz395sx91z3"))))
+        (base32 "1ic501bv24racms7gissz8v7axf71irrd134ljsjx557zv5p3w91"))))
     (build-system cargo-build-system)
     (arguments
-     `(#:cargo-inputs (("rust-proc-macro-crate" ,rust-proc-macro-crate-3)
-                       ("rust-proc-macro2" ,rust-proc-macro2-1)
+     `(#:cargo-inputs (("rust-proc-macro2" ,rust-proc-macro2-1)
                        ("rust-quote" ,rust-quote-1)
                        ("rust-syn" ,rust-syn-2)
                        ("rust-wayrs-proto-parser" 
,rust-wayrs-proto-parser-2))))
@@ -5736,6 +5735,25 @@ with wayrs-client.")
 from xml files.")
     (license license:expat)))
 
+(define-public rust-wayrs-scanner-0.13
+  (package
+    (inherit rust-wayrs-scanner-0.15)
+    (name "rust-wayrs-scanner")
+    (version "0.13.2")
+    (source
+     (origin
+       (method url-fetch)
+       (uri (crate-uri "wayrs-scanner" version))
+       (file-name (string-append name "-" version ".tar.gz"))
+       (sha256
+        (base32 "07xzg36rnnsb4z4rd82r2mk3y05vg1ssfwrry2kd4yz395sx91z3"))))
+    (arguments
+     `(#:cargo-inputs (("rust-proc-macro-crate" ,rust-proc-macro-crate-3)
+                       ("rust-proc-macro2" ,rust-proc-macro2-1)
+                       ("rust-quote" ,rust-quote-1)
+                       ("rust-syn" ,rust-syn-2)
+                       ("rust-wayrs-proto-parser" 
,rust-wayrs-proto-parser-2))))))
+
 (define-public rust-webp-0.3
   (package
     (name "rust-webp")



reply via email to

[Prev in Thread] Current Thread [Next in Thread]